My circuit breaker feels warm. Is this related to the electrical panel overheating issues common in Hilton?

It could be. A warm or hot circuit breaker panel is a warning sign we take seriously here in Hilton. It often indicates overloaded circuits, outdated components, or loose connections, which can lead to overheating and potential hazards. We recommend having it inspected promptly. Our team is experienced in diagnosing and resolving these specific local issues, whether it requires rebalancing your home's electrical load, upgrading the panel, or replacing damaged components to ensure safe, reliable operation.
